Yes, the hot tub is kind of off the kitchen! Behind the kitchen is the breakfast nook, and then there's the addition to the house straight behind. The doors to the deck are there and then the hot tub with a bathroom right beside (which I didn't take pictures of)
It was moved into town in 1997 from farmland. These houses were ordered from the Eaton's catalogue and delivered by train! You would get all the wood, nails, windows, doors, hinges, etc to build the whole place! That is just how the prairie farmers shopped ![]() ![]() ![]()
